Now how do you feel about other types of tools in the shop? Are you more likely to, keep tools because there is a small chance you will use it again some day or get rid of a unused tool? Cluttered or clean shop?
I think the answer to that question comes down to the nature of those tools. There are some specialty things that rarely get used, but when they are the right tool for the job...they are the right tool for the job. There are other things that we sometimes "collect" on whims that count more as clutter. My recent shop move really revealed some of that stuff for sure!
The thing with clamps...even the most despised clamp becomes your favorite when it's the last one you have available to use in a glue up that's in progress. (For me, those are some pipe clamps that stay stored away for "that time" when extras are needed)
